956 United is a youth soccer organization operating in the Rio Grande Valley (RGV) region of Texas. The club launched in May 2022 with a mission to enhance soccer opportunities for everyone in the RGV. They cater to various youth age groups, including U12 and U16, as evidenced by their "Gu12 USA Cup Qualifier Champions" and "BU16 (2008) NATIONAL CHAMPIONS" titles. A notable achievement includes their BU16 (2008) team winning a national championship. 956 United emphasizes player development, with a focus on college placement, as demonstrated by college signings. The club offers participation in prominent competitive soccer leagues and programs, including MLS WDDOA Frontier, ECNL/RL, and DPL. They also host tournaments such as the International Winter Cup.

IDEA Toros Futbol Academy is a youth soccer program operating within the IDEA Public Schools network, primarily serving the Mid Rio Grande Valley region of Texas, with specific mention of Pharr. Established in 2016, the academy is a sports-centric charter school with a unique partnership to local semi-professional organizations. It serves students in grades 8-12, with competitive athletic teams beginning in middle school and high school. The program is deeply integrated into IDEA Public Schools' mission of "College for all children," aiming to develop students with academic, social, and leadership characteristics essential for college success. IDEA Toros Futbol Academy is a member club of the MLS NEXT Homegrown Division, providing a pathway for elite youth development. The academy also competes in competitive interscholastic leagues, including the Texas Charter Schools Academic and Athletic League, where both boys' and girls' teams have achieved state championships. A key feature is the emphasis on cultivating perseverance, resilience, teamwork, and leadership skills through its athletic programs. The academy assists in the college placement of its student-athletes, aligning with the broader educational goals of IDEA Public Schools.
